What to Expect

If you suspect that you or someone in your family might be suffering from ADHD, a proper diagnosis is crucial. The best method to obtain this is to have an individual assessment with a specialist who has expertise in diagnosing ADHD in adults. You should be prepared to spend some time during the process, since it can last up to three hours. During the screening, you will be asked about your family history, your personal health and any symptoms you may be experiencing. You will also be asked questions about your family, home or work environment as well as any symptoms that you may be experiencing.

You will also be asked to complete an inventory of symptoms as well as be asked how long you have been experiencing these symptoms and what effect they have on your life. You will be asked whether you experience difficulties at the workplace or at school and how often you experience feelings of anxiety, disorganization or emotional dysregulation. Your doctor will then review your medical history and results of the symptoms checklist. This is to ensure you don't have a medical condition such as depression or anxiety that can cause similar problems such as ADHD.

It could involve talking to someone you had contact with as when you were a child (such as a parent, sibling or friend) to get information about childhood ADHD symptoms you might experience. They might also ask you to complete questionnaires that have been sent to you ahead of the appointment. They will also review any school reports you have provided in the event that they are available.

It is important to note that GPs are not able to diagnose ADHD, and only specialists are able to do this. If your GP doesn't agree that you suffer from ADHD they'll be able to tell you why. It could be because they didn't hear enough detail about your difficulties or they believe that a different condition explains your symptoms better than ADHD does.

Many people diagnosed with ADHD find that it clarifies a lot about their struggles, and is a huge relief to them. It is important to be aware of side effects and consult their psychiatrist prior to making any changes to treatment.

Many people prefer to have a full diagnostic interview with a doctor instead of simply being prescribed medication. This enables a doctor to discuss the symptoms the patient is experiencing and how they impact their daily lives.

During an adult adhd evaluation the doctor will inquire about the patient's early life, adulthood and current life. They will also ask the patient to rate their behaviors in different situations, and in different social contexts. Most often an individual from the family is invited to the appointment to collect additional information, however this is not always required.

If a diagnosis is made of ADHD, the doctor will submit an assessment to the patient's GP. The doctor will discuss the findings with the patient before deciding on the treatment plan. In some cases, medication may be prescribed. The GP will typically arrange for the pharmacy to get prescriptions for a medication that has been prescribed.

If a person wishes to continue private healthcare and receive medication on a regular basis, they will need to sign a shared care agreement with the consultant psychiatrist. This will keep the GP informed about the progress of the patient and assist maintain continuity of care. Additionally the GP can reach out to the psychiatrist consultant for advice as needed.

Insurance

The cost of an adhd private assessment could be high but, should you are covered by health insurance or have other funding sources there is a chance that the test could be covered by your insurance. It is contingent on the particular policy you have, so make sure to check with your insurance company to find out whether they cover an ADHD assessment.

The majority of insurance companies will provide an assessment for ADHD in the event that it falls within the scope of mental health benefits. However some insurance companies have strict guidelines for the types of treatment they will cover and may only cover the diagnosis if it's considered to be serious. It isn't easy for those who have an unassailable case of the disorder, even though they have a valid diagnosis, to get coverage.

It could take an extended time to convince your insurance company to cover an assessment of your private adhd but it's well worth pushing through the red-tape. The key is to keep good records of your interactions with the insurance company as well as any documents you provide to prove that your claim is valid. Be sure to keep the names and numbers of any people you talk to and the dates of each interaction. It is also helpful to have a doctor sign medical necessity letters that confirms the need for treatment. This will help in your battle against the insurance company.

If your insurance policy covers an adhd private assessment, it is likely that they will also cover the cost of any medication that might be prescribed in connection with the diagnosis. This could be a huge savings, particularly when your child is diagnosed with mild to moderate ADHD and has been having difficulty in school.

We recently reviewed the terms and conditions of four major UK private health insurance providers: Axa PPP Aviva Bupa Vitality Health. Bupa is the only one that will cover an ADHD assessment.

Finding a Diagnostic

It is crucial that a person undergo an extensive evaluation and testing process in order to determine if they suffer from ADHD. It is crucial to find an expert who has expertise in ADHD assessment and diagnosis. It can be difficult to find the right expert at first. However, you can take the guesswork out by asking friends and family members for recommendations or searching on the internet for professionals with the required credentials.

It is recommended to first talk to your GP to let them know that you or your child could be suffering from ADHD. Your GP must take this seriously and recommend you to an ADHD specialist if required.

If you're taken to an ADHD specialist The initial ADHD evaluation should last about two hours. During this time, your healthcare professional will go over all of your symptoms and any which aren't readily visible. They'll also consider how they impact your life and wellbeing and suggest the best treatment plan for you.

You'll be asked to fill out several questionnaires prior to your appointment. These questionnaires are based upon symptoms common to ADHD and can aid the doctor in determining if you have ADHD. Once you have completed the questionnaire, your doctor will conduct a physical exam and take notes. They will also perform a psychological assessment.

You will receive a report and recommendations after the assessment. Your doctor will discuss the findings and may prescribe medication or suggest alternatives to the treatment.

It can be frustrating and confusing to be given the diagnosis of ADHD particularly for those who haven't been diagnosed. Many of them have had to struggle to cope with unruly behaviours that they assumed were normal aspects of childhood.

A recent Panorama investigation found shocking evidence that some private clinics are giving out unreliable ADHD diagnoses. This can put vulnerable people at risk and render them unable to receive the care they require. The investigation highlights the need for a better system of care to ensure that patients are treated by experts with the appropriate skills as well as the knowledge and experience.
